Abstract :
Compared with traditional verification method for structural correctness of model based on Petri net graph reduction, The method in text adds reduction methods for the general iterative structure and the adjacent structure. A method for converting the non-freely chosen WF-net model into the freely chosen WF-net model in equivalence is put forward, therefore realizing the verification for all kinds of workflow process model.
